1. One-Pan Lemon Garlic Chicken

One-pan meals are a lifesaver for busy nights. This lemon garlic chicken is tangy, flavorful, and requires minimal clean-up.

Ingredients:

IngredientQuantity
Chicken breasts4
Lemon juice1/4 cup
Garlic cloves, minced3
Olive oil2 tbsp
Salt & pepperTo taste

Instructions:

  1.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
  2. In a bowl, mix lemon juice, minced garlic, and olive oil.
  3. Season the chicken with salt and pepper, then coat it with the lemon-garlic mixture.
  4. Arrange the chicken breasts on a sheet pan and bake for 20-25 minutes until cooked through.
  5. Serve with your choice of veggies or a simple side salad.

This recipe is light, fresh, and perfect for a quick weeknight meal. It’s also a great base for meal-prepping—you can use the leftover chicken for salads, wraps, or sandwiches throughout the week.

2. Instant Pot Honey Garlic Chicken

If you have an Instant Pot, this recipe will become your new best friend. Sweet, savory, and full of flavor, honey garlic chicken is a family favorite—and the Instant Pot cuts down cooking time dramatically.

Ingredients:

IngredientQuantity
Chicken thighs6
Honey1/4 cup
Soy sauce1/4 cup
Garlic cloves, minced4
Rice vinegar1 tbsp

Instructions:

  1. Add all the ingredients to your Instant Pot.
  2. Seal the lid and set it to high pressure for 15 minutes.
  3. Once the time is up, release the pressure quickly.
  4. Serve over rice or noodles with a sprinkle of sesame seeds or chopped green onions for garnish.

This recipe delivers a bold, sticky-sweet sauce that clings to every bite of tender chicken. Perfect for pairing with rice or noodles, and you can even add steamed veggies on the side.

3. Sheet Pan Chicken Fajitas

Craving Mexican flavors but don’t want to spend all evening chopping and stirring? Sheet pan fajitas are the answer. This one-pan wonder requires only about 10 minutes of prep and bakes in under 20 minutes.

Ingredients:

IngredientQuantity
Chicken breast strips4
Bell peppers, sliced2
Onion, sliced1
Fajita seasoning2 tbsp
Olive oil1 tbsp

Instructions:

  1. Preheat your oven to 425°F (220°C).
  2. Toss the chicken, peppers, and onions with olive oil and fajita seasoning.
  3. Spread the mixture onto a sheet pan and bake for 20 minutes.
  4. Serve with warm tortillas, rice, or over a bed of lettuce for a lighter option.

The beauty of this recipe is that everything cooks at the same time, making it a perfect no-fuss dinner.

4. 30-Minute Creamy Tuscan Chicken

Rich, creamy, and bursting with flavor, Tuscan chicken is an indulgent meal that still comes together in about 30 minutes. The creamy sauce, made with sun-dried tomatoes and spinach, pairs perfectly with pasta or a side of garlic bread.

Ingredients:

IngredientQuantity
Chicken breasts4
Heavy cream1 cup
Sun-dried tomatoes, sliced1/2 cup
Fresh spinach2 cups
Garlic, minced2 cloves

Instructions:

  1. In a large pan, sear the chicken breasts on both sides until golden brown.
  2. Remove the chicken from the pan, and in the same pan, sauté the garlic, sun-dried tomatoes, and spinach.
  3. Add the cream and stir until the sauce thickens slightly.
  4. Return the chicken to the pan and simmer for another 10 minutes, until fully cooked.

Creamy, flavorful, and satisfying, this dish feels like it came from a restaurant but can be made in the comfort of your kitchen.

5. Grilled BBQ Chicken Thighs

BBQ chicken thighs are perfect for grilling, and their juicy, tender texture makes them hard to resist. The quick marinade gives these thighs bold, smoky flavors, and they’re ready to hit the grill after just a few minutes of prep.

Ingredients:

IngredientQuantity
Chicken thighs, bone-in6
BBQ sauce1/2 cup
Olive oil2 tbsp
Paprika1 tsp
Garlic powder1 tsp

Instructions:

  1. Mix the BBQ sauce, olive oil, paprika, and garlic powder in a bowl.
  2. Coat the chicken thighs in the marinade and let them sit for 10 minutes (or longer if you have time).
  3. Preheat your grill to medium heat and grill the chicken for 6-8 minutes per side, or until fully cooked.
  4. Brush on extra BBQ sauce during the last few minutes of grilling for extra flavor.

Serve these BBQ chicken thighs with coleslaw, corn on the cob, or potato salad for a complete meal.

6. Crispy Chicken Tenders

These crispy, golden chicken tenders are a kid-friendly favorite and take less than 30 minutes to make. Pair them with your favorite dipping sauce, and you’ve got a meal that’s sure to please even the pickiest eaters.

Ingredients:

IngredientQuantity
Chicken tenders8
Flour1/2 cup
Eggs, beaten2
Breadcrumbs1 cup
Olive oil2 tbsp

Instructions:

  1.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C) and grease a baking sheet.
  2. Dredge the chicken tenders in flour, dip in the beaten eggs, and coat with breadcrumbs.
  3. Arrange the tenders on the baking sheet and drizzle with olive oil.
  4. Bake for 20-25 minutes until golden brown and crispy.

These baked tenders are a healthier alternative to fried ones, but they still deliver that satisfying crunch.
